Printed Circuit Assembly refers to the indispensable process in which electronic parts are mounted onto a PCB, therefore producing a fully working electronic circuit. The precision required in this assembly process ensures that the electric paths in between parts are faultlessly attached, taking advantage of the PCB's layout to achieve the desired capability. With the introduction of High Density Interconnect (HDI) PCBs, this assembly procedure has ended up being much more intricate yet considerably extra powerful. HDI PCBs are defined by their greater wiring density each location as contrasted to traditional PCBs. This density is accomplished via the use of finer lines and areas, smaller sized vias and capture pads, and higher connection pad density. The end result of these elements enables a majority of interconnections in a given area, hence enabling much more small, reliable, and high-performance electronic products.

The evolution of HDI PCB board assembly is closely linked to the demand for miniaturization in consumer electronics, telecommunications equipment, and progressed medical devices. These industries need progressively complicated PCBs that can sustain a plethora of features while inhabiting marginal room. In regards to PCB board assembly manufacturing, HDI modern technology mandates extra innovative strategies, such as laser-drilled microvias and progressed lamination procedures, to produce multi-layered boards with precision. This complexity underscores the crucial role of experienced manufacturers and assemblers who have the technical knowledge and abilities to deliver premium HDI PCB products.

Flexible Printed Circuit Boards (flex PCBs) and flexible printed circuit settings up additionally show the dynamic extent of PCB innovation. Flex PCBs differ significantly from typical rigid circuit boards as they are built using flexible materials, generally polyimide, which permits the board to flex and flex without damage.

Bendable circuit boards, or flex PCBs, are built to sustain mechanical anxiety and bending, making them extremely suitable for irregular and vibrant form aspects. The manufacturing procedure of flex PCBs includes numerous steps, including the application of flexible substratums, the careful positioning of conductive paths, and the incorporation of surface area place innovations that make certain the reliability of elements also under flexing conditions. Flexible PCB vendors and manufacturers must pay precise interest to factors such as the material's flexibility, the attachment of copper traces, and the overall durability of the assembly to guarantee product long life and efficiency.
